Transaction 66030e33cbaeb2d79ead1d44edfb14dc4a1cddf928c5e611b7b5cdb577316dae
1 Input
2 Outputs
- 66030e33cbaeb2d79ead1d44edfb14dc4a1cddf928c5e611b7b5cdb577316dae:0
- 66030e33cbaeb2d79ead1d44edfb14dc4a1cddf928c5e611b7b5cdb577316dae:1
value 23670
address 1BCc3yZrWydeRsdewXgp1nn9SVtTxHioKT
value 1452509
address 3HDEyZXvkS2aACqrd5EuKM78sSeeRRnc23